Marriage and Happiness

This might be irresponsible of us not to bring up some crucial caveats to such findings. First, researchers have shown that being married leads people to report that they are happier with their lives in general (in part because the question itself probably compels them to weigh the fact of being married as signifying greater happiness), but being married does not necessarily lead people to experience more happiness moment to moment. For an instance, a study that tracked how married women occupy their time during every hour of the day found that marriage confers both benefits and costs to women, and that these benefits and costs appear to offset one another. So, married women spend less time alone than their unmarried peers and more time having sex, but they also spend less time with friends, less time reading or watching TV, and more time doing chores, preparing food, and tending to children including other as usual things.
